Born in the ghettos of Los Angeles in the ’90s, Krump has a cathartic power. For hip-hop choreographers Annabelle Loiseau and Pierre Bolo, Krump is an extraordinary, spectacular dance. When they take it on, the dancers are overcome by a ferocious energy that tears them away from themselves. In this new creation, the two artists infuse it with a rare musicality, making Brut(es) an explosive visual piece in which five performers give a glimpse of this explosive discipline.
